Can’t believe it has been 5 years already, but our brothers and sisters to the North in Portland, Oregon are about to celebrate 5 year birthday. They are going to have a big group show at FIFTY24PDX to honor the occasion… here is the press…

Fifty24PDX Gallery presents “High Five!”, a group show featuring artwork from Ryan Bubnis, Bradley Delay, Meredith Dittmar, Jeremy Fish, Sam Flores, Bishop Lennon, Justin Lovato, Munk One, Amy Ruppel, and Skinner.

The evening will also mark the release of a brand new giclée print by Sam Flores, limited to an edition of 50, available exclusively at Upper Playground Portland. Sam Flores will be signing in the gallery from 6pm-9pm. Artists Ryan Bubnis, Bradley Delay, Meredith Dittmar, Bishop Lennon, and Amy Ruppel will be in attendance.

Beer provided by Red Hook, and Over the Top Burger will set up shop outside to slay your hunger with delicious wild game burgers.

The night will continue with the official after party down the street at The Fix at Someday Lounge, with a photo booth, giveaways, and more. DJ Kez, Rev Shines, and Dundiggy will be spinning the best and rarest of hip hop, funk, soul, rare groove, afro-beat, latin, and baile funk.

“See you in Croatan” is an experimental research project which will cross the lives and experiences of two friends in a random road trip across the west coast of the United States. As far away as possible from doctrines, imperialisms and linear reasoning. Searching for beauty in errors and fortuitous tools. Working with intuition and hazard; trying to light relations, transitions and processes; working with research as the way itself; understanding chaos as an ideal space for creation.

And it opens tonight in San Francisco… and it stars Spanish artists, San and Escif.
